草庐IT

FPGA学习3-Vivado简易使用方法

一、创建Vivado工程1)启动Vivado,在Windows中可以通过双击Vivado快捷方式启动;linux在终端source/tools/Xilinx/Vivado/...../settings64.sh    vivado&2)在Vivado开发环境里点击“CreateNewProject”,创建一个新的工程,向导界面点击next,填写工程名,next 3)工程类选择RTLPROJECT,NEXT,目标语言可以选择Verilog,仿真语言选混合,下一步next, 4)Part选择所需器件,其中speed为速度-1表示的速度等级,越大,速度越快。选好后点击finish5)软件界面 二、创

FPGA学习3-Vivado简易使用方法

一、创建Vivado工程1)启动Vivado,在Windows中可以通过双击Vivado快捷方式启动;linux在终端source/tools/Xilinx/Vivado/...../settings64.sh    vivado&2)在Vivado开发环境里点击“CreateNewProject”,创建一个新的工程,向导界面点击next,填写工程名,next 3)工程类选择RTLPROJECT,NEXT,目标语言可以选择Verilog,仿真语言选混合,下一步next, 4)Part选择所需器件,其中speed为速度-1表示的速度等级,越大,速度越快。选好后点击finish5)软件界面 二、创

IP核之RAM实验

        RAM的英文全称是RandomAccessMemory,即随机存取存储器,它可以随时把数据写入任一指定地址的存储单元,也可以随时从任一指定地址中读出数据,其读写速度是由时钟频率决定的。RAM主要用来存放程序及程序执行过程中产生的中间数据、运算结果等。本章我们将对Vivado软件生成的RAMIP核进行读写测试,并向大家介绍XilinxRAMIP核的使用方法。RAMIP核简介        Xilinx7系列器件具有嵌入式存储器结构,满足了设计对片上存储器的需求。嵌入式存储器结构由一列列BRAM(块RAM)存储器模块组成,通过对这些BRAM存储器模块进行配置,可以实现各种存储器的功

IP核之RAM实验

        RAM的英文全称是RandomAccessMemory,即随机存取存储器,它可以随时把数据写入任一指定地址的存储单元,也可以随时从任一指定地址中读出数据,其读写速度是由时钟频率决定的。RAM主要用来存放程序及程序执行过程中产生的中间数据、运算结果等。本章我们将对Vivado软件生成的RAMIP核进行读写测试,并向大家介绍XilinxRAMIP核的使用方法。RAMIP核简介        Xilinx7系列器件具有嵌入式存储器结构,满足了设计对片上存储器的需求。嵌入式存储器结构由一列列BRAM(块RAM)存储器模块组成,通过对这些BRAM存储器模块进行配置,可以实现各种存储器的功

Hadoop 简介

一、Hadoop是什么Hadoop是一个提供分布式存储和计算的开源软件框架,它具有无共享、高可用(HA)、弹性可扩展的特点,非常适合处理海量数量。Hadoop是一个开源软件框架Hadoop适合处理大规模数据Hadoop被部署在一个可扩展的集群服务器上二、Hadoop三大核心组件HDFS(分布式文件系统)-——实现将文件分布式存储在集群服务器上MAPREDUCE(分布式运算编程框架)——实现在集群服务器上分布式并行运算YARN(分布式资源调度系统)——帮用户调度大量的MapReduce程序,并合理分配运算资源(CPU和内存) 1.X和2.X版本的区别1、HDFS定义HDFS(HadoopDist

Hadoop 简介

一、Hadoop是什么Hadoop是一个提供分布式存储和计算的开源软件框架,它具有无共享、高可用(HA)、弹性可扩展的特点,非常适合处理海量数量。Hadoop是一个开源软件框架Hadoop适合处理大规模数据Hadoop被部署在一个可扩展的集群服务器上二、Hadoop三大核心组件HDFS(分布式文件系统)-——实现将文件分布式存储在集群服务器上MAPREDUCE(分布式运算编程框架)——实现在集群服务器上分布式并行运算YARN(分布式资源调度系统)——帮用户调度大量的MapReduce程序,并合理分配运算资源(CPU和内存) 1.X和2.X版本的区别1、HDFS定义HDFS(HadoopDist

Elasticsearch基础语法

ES基础语法创建一个索引PUT/test{   "settings":{      "number_of_shards":1,      "number_of_replicas":1   }分布式节点建设更新其replicas状态,但是不能更新shards状态PUT/test/_settings{   "settings":{      "number_of_replicas":0   }}创建索引,指定id建立索引PUT/employee/_doc/1{    "name":"凯杰",    "age":30}指定id全量修改索引PUT/employee/_doc/1{    "name":

Elasticsearch基础语法

ES基础语法创建一个索引PUT/test{   "settings":{      "number_of_shards":1,      "number_of_replicas":1   }分布式节点建设更新其replicas状态,但是不能更新shards状态PUT/test/_settings{   "settings":{      "number_of_replicas":0   }}创建索引,指定id建立索引PUT/employee/_doc/1{    "name":"凯杰",    "age":30}指定id全量修改索引PUT/employee/_doc/1{    "name":

Vivado软件的使用

目录1新建工程1.1 FlowNavigator1.2数据窗口区域1.3Properties窗口1.4工作空间(Workspace)1.5结果窗口区域1.6主工具栏1.7主菜单1.8窗口布局(Layout)选择器2设计输入修改字体大小3分析与综合4约束输入5设计实现6下载比特流1新建工程        双击Vivado2018.3        点击“CreateProject”1Vivado软件启动界面2 新建工程向导3输入工程名称和路径4 工程类型的选择5添加源文件的界面​​​​​​6添加约束文件7ZYNQ-7010核心板芯片型号8工程概览(Summary)页面        工程创建完成

Vivado软件的使用

目录1新建工程1.1 FlowNavigator1.2数据窗口区域1.3Properties窗口1.4工作空间(Workspace)1.5结果窗口区域1.6主工具栏1.7主菜单1.8窗口布局(Layout)选择器2设计输入修改字体大小3分析与综合4约束输入5设计实现6下载比特流1新建工程        双击Vivado2018.3        点击“CreateProject”1Vivado软件启动界面2 新建工程向导3输入工程名称和路径4 工程类型的选择5添加源文件的界面​​​​​​6添加约束文件7ZYNQ-7010核心板芯片型号8工程概览(Summary)页面        工程创建完成